Side chair

The Metropolitan Museum of Art

Black side chair with a tall back, curved sides, and a curved top rail. The back has a central design element with curved lines extending down from it, resembling a vase or urn shape. The seat is upholstered in black leather with rows of metal studs along the front edge. The legs are straight and tapered, connected by stretchers. The chair appears to be made of wood.
